/ˈdɒmɪsaɪl əv tʃɔɪs/ – Phrase
Definition: Chỗ ở chọn lựa.
A more thorough explanation: 1. the place where a company has chosen to be based
2. the place where a person has chosen to live, rather than the place where they come from. The term is often used in connection with taxation.
Example: 1. Bermuda was the domicile of choice for 57 percent of Insurance Linked Securities in 2014.
2. An application for a Cayman domicile of choice requires you to form the intention to remain in Cayman permanently or indefinitely.
